I filed my return claiming the premium tax credit. Why did I get a letter from the IRS asking for more information and a copy of my 1095-A? You do not have to send your Form 1095-A to the IRS with your tax return when you file and claim the premium tax credit.

Do I need to attach 1095-A?

This form provides information about your Marketplace coverage. Use Form 1095-A to complete Form 8962 PDF and reconcile advance payments of the premium tax credit or claim the premium tax credit on your tax return. Do not attach Form 1095-A to your tax return – keep it with your tax records.

What if I lost my 1095-a form?

What to Do if a Taxpayer Loses or Did Not Receive Form 1095-A

  1. Log-in to their account on the website of the Federal or the State Marketplace they obtained their health insurance from and see if their Form 1095-A is available as a PDF.
  2. Call the Federal or State Marketplace and have a replacement copy mailed to them.

How do I correct a 1095-A?

Check your 1095-A to make sure it’s correct Carefully read the instructions on the back, and make sure the information is accurate. If anything about your household or coverage is wrong, contact the Marketplace Call Center. They’ll send a corrected version.

How do I request a 1095-A?

How to find your 1095-A online

  1. Log in to your HealthCare.gov account.
  2. Under “Your Existing Applications,” select your 2020 application — not your 2021 application.
  3. Select “Tax Forms” from the menu on the left.
  4. Download all 1095-As shown on the screen.

Where can I get a copy of my Form 1095?

If you purchased coverage through a state-based Marketplace, you may be able to get an electronic copy of Form 1095-A from your state-based Marketplace account. Visit your Marketplace’s website to find out the steps you need to follow to get a copy of your 1095-A online.

When do I get my health insurance Form 1095-A?

It may be available in your HealthCare.gov account as soon as mid-January. IMPORTANT: You must have your 1095-A before you file. Your 1095-A includes information about Marketplace plans anyone in your household had in 2019. It comes from the Marketplace, not the IRS.

What should I do if I receive a corrected Form 1095-A?

If you believe your Form 1095-A is incorrect, you should contact the state or federal Marketplace from which you received coverage. The Marketplace may need to send you a corrected Form 1095-A. Q. What should I do if I receive a corrected or voided Form 1095-A? If you receive a corrected or voided Form 1095-A, you may need to amend your return.

Can you get more than one form 1095a?

You may receive more than one Form 1095-A if members of your household were not all enrolled in the same health plan, you updated your family information during the year, you switched plans during the year, or you had family members enrolled in different states.
